News and Links
Protocol
- EIP1011 deprecated in favor of casper + sharding. It “brings us to a full-PoS, sharded, scalable blockchain much sooner”
- New Casper+Sharding spec
- Drake: Artificial beacon chain penalties
- Casey Detrio: Synchronous cross-shard transactions with consolidated concurrency control and consensus
- Drake: Optimised handling of proposer and attester signatures
- Buterin: Attestation committee based full PoS chains
- Latest Casper standup
- Tom Close: Force-Move games state channels framework
- Fichter: Griefing Vectors in Confirmation Signatures
- Double Batched Merkle Log Accumulators to make Plasma commitments cheaper
- Paying rent with deposits?
- UTexas paper on merkleizing levelDB for Ethereum
- Latest core devs call. Lane’s notes.
- Swarm PoC3 released
Stuff for developers
- Zkstark mixer Miximus is live on Rinkeby
- There’s been a decent chunk of the network used recently by airdrops, so Jeff Coleman reminds projects that they can save lots of money by using Richard Moore’s Merkle Air Drops
- MetaMask will no longer reload pages on network change
- Exploring Eth storage cost with FOAM’s dev tools
- 7 challenges in Dharma’s JS fiddle
- A rough ERC721 implementation in Vyper from Maurelian
- IPFS Pubsub React boilerplate
- UI for the simplest multisig wallet
- Cava: core libraries for blockchain dev in Java and Kotlin
- Embark v3.1 - better testing, lightweight wallet functionality, a transaction logger, profiler, clever imports, ENS support
- Truffle v4.1.12
- Comprehensive list of Solidity attack vectors and how to avoid them
Ecosystem
- Status unveiled Nimbus, an Eth client in Nim for resource constrained devices. More from Status: building custom mailservers and bootnodes, which they needed to get around Russian anti-Telegram IP blocking
- Parity: why we believe in WASM, though Brendan Eich has some skepticism
- MyCrypto v1.1 with address book
- Nick Johnson’s state of ENS slides
- CryptoPrimitive Academy – free series of dapp dev seminars starting next Monday
- A Whisper explainer
- AirSwap: decentralized exchanges are the web3 app stores
- VIPNode update
- Verifying identify in Venezuela using Zeppelin’s Transaction Permission Layer
- All uPort protocols and libraries
- Latest Open Block Explorers call
Live on mainnet
- SpankChain’s public beta went live on mainnet
- Dharma relayer Bloqboard is live on mainnet
- iEx.ec deployed their marketplace and hub contracts on mainnet in a soft launch. Public working pools in September
Governance and Standards
- I was wrong last week. ERC721 is now officially finalized with a relatively last minute breaking change
- EIP1153: transient storage opcodes. FEM discussion.
- ERC1129: standardized dapp announcements
- ERC1154: Oracle interface
- ERC1155: mint ERC20 and ERC721 tokens in same contract
- ERC1167: Minimal proxy contract
- ERC1152: Access control with NFTs
- ERC1172: wallet and shop standard for tokens
- ERC1165: registry for human-readable contract descriptions
- Some discussion on ERC792 arbitration standard
- Dean Eigenmann’s meditations on what we can learn from the EOS governance anti-pattern.
- How Nexus Mutual is thinking about DAO governance
- Kent Barton’s 5 takeaways from the recent Ethereum values survey
Project Updates
- Loom Network’s Zombie Battleground NFT card game is on Kickstarter and has already raised $210k out of 250k in less than a week
- The 6 companies tokenizing their equity with Neufund
- An AMA with Althea Mesh
- Iconomi Q2 dev update
- FunFair to launch their own casino to dogfood their product
- AXA’s “Fizzy” flight delay insurance now open to French and Italians and publishes its code which notarizes your transaction.
- You can now use your Gnosis tokens to generate OWL
- Optionality token options trading platform live on Kovan
- Grid+ imminent regulatory approval to sell electricity at retail
- Kleros will provide decentralized arbitration for seasteading
- NYTimes writeup of ex-Denver Post folks joining Civil
- Userfeeds is shutting down current company but CTO is raising money to focus on being a product instead of platform
- Colony live on Rinkeby testnet for devs in their hackathon. Also, the Colony stack
- Maker DAO’s Foundation Proposal – the first vote on Aug 22
Interviews, Podcasts, Videos, Talks
- Hashing It Out discussion of Casper + Sharding
- Mythril’s Gerhard Wagner on Smartest Contract
- All the videos from Oslo Blockchain Day
- State channel panel at MIT’s Layer 2 summit
- Emin Gün Sirer talk on Avalanche
- Alejandro Machado talks crypto use in his native Venezuela
- Spankchain’s Ameen Soleimani on Smartest Contract
- John Pacific and David Nuñez from NuCypher on Hashing It Out
- Coinbase’s Adam White with Laura Shin
Tokens
- Inflation funding in practice in Livepeer. Paratii also looking to incent curation through inflation
- Curation markets with infinite staking
- Artonomous – Simon de la Rouviere experiment to sell daily art on curved bond
- Mapping the NFT landscape
- Foam’s TCRs for points of interest on maps
- Gatekeepers : TCRs and work tokens for access control
- Vitalik’s slides on mechanism design challenges
General
- Ethereum Foundation helps underwrite for Stanford’s new Center for Blockchain Research
- How do you get your kids to do chores? You IoT the heck out of your house with chore tracking and then pay your kids in crypto on completion.
- Lots of Ethereum in lastest Thiel Fellows
- Docusign will let you store a document hash on Ethereum
- EY and Microsoft launch content permissions and royalties management using Quorum that will be used first for XBox game publishers.
- Tether releases independent report of fiat matching Tether supply
- Be wary of MetaMask phishing attempts from Cloudflare security holes
Dates of Note
Upcoming dates of note:
- June 24 — Colony online hackathon finishes
- June 25 — Etherisc token sale starts
- June 28 — BuildEth (San Francisco)
- June 30 — Solidity Gas Golfing challenge deadline
- June 30-July1 — Off the chain state channel workshop (Berlin)
- July 6-7 — TechCrunch blockchain and Ethereum events (Zug)
- July 9 — Augur scheduled to launch
- July 12 — Sharding and Casper workshop with Karl Floersch and Justin Drake (New Delhi)
- July 12-18 — IC3 Eth Bootcamp (Ithaca, NY)
- July 14-15 — FEM governance meetings in Berlin
- July 19-20 — DappCon (Berlin)
- July 24-26 — NIFTY hackathon and NFT conference (Hong Kong)
- August 3-4 — Discon (Boulder, CO)
- August 10-12 — EthIndia hackathon (Bangalore)
- August 22 — Maker DAO ‘Foundation Proposal’ vote
- September 6 — Security unconference (Berlin)
- September 7-9 — EthBerlin hackathon
- September 7-9 — WyoHackathon (Wyoming)
- Oct 5-7 — TruffleCon in Portland
- Oct 5-7 — EthSanFrancisco hackathon
- Oct 22-24 — Web3Summit (Berlin)
- Oct 30 – Nov 2 — Devcon4 (Prague)
- December — EthSingapore hackathon
If you appreciate this newsletter, thank ConsenSys
I’m thankful that ConsenSys has brought me on and given me time to do this newsletter.
Editorial control is 100% me. If you’re unhappy with editorial decisions, blame me.
Shameless self-promotion
Most of what I link to I tweet first: @evan_van_ness
This newsletter is supported by ConsenSys